Abstract

A system for distributed file storage includes a plurality of servers providing, to a plurality of clients, file access services for accessing files stored on the plurality of servers. A list of neighbor servers is maintained by each server. The neighbor servers are a subset of the plurality of servers. At least one server of the plurality of servers is switched into a neighbor group of servers based on network distance. Each file is stored in the form of a plurality of N pieces on N servers, the pieces being generated from the file. The list is used to obtain information for reconstructing files stored on the neighbor servers, such that any K out of the N pieces can be used to reconstruct any file.
